Output e8430655c70fdc1f0e0d2348a4d56eae2272694991c43433d624b61d73aa780c:0

value
18725762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b09f33a969a52d251dc0a4bdcdba712929664b8 OP_EQUAL
address
375BiCzxjS6PdWx7ALnRX82KoRE7xqm3KB
transaction
e8430655c70fdc1f0e0d2348a4d56eae2272694991c43433d624b61d73aa780c